Abstract | A color printer control system comprising a user interface for shifting color hue. A control panel display includes an illustrative representation such as a color spectrum bar for suggesting a color range for both the input document and the output document. The user interface has a selective control such as a slide bar including an indicator of a user preference relative to the color reference bar. The position of the slide bar represents the hue shift input by the user. A dynamic image representation, such as a photograph, concurrently adjusts its hue in accordance with adjustment of the color slide bar and the user command. The dynamic image shifts color hue to provide a more accurate indication of the effects of hue shift to the user. |
